Jackson l, ma a, faulder k.Retrieval of a fractured marathon microcatheter entrapped in onyx using a novel stentriever-assisted tec hnique.Operative neurosurgery (b)(6).2022;23(4):e304-e308.Doi:10.1227/ons.0000000000000305 medtronic literature review found a report of patient complications in association with a marathon catheter and onyx.The purpose of this article was to present the first case using a novel stentriever-assisted technique to successfully and safely retrieve a fractured microcatheter entrapped in onyx.The following intra- or post-procedural outcomes were noted: - a patient with a cognard iia + b dural arteriovenous fistula (davf) underwent onyx embolization.The marathon microcatheter became entrapped and fractured while initially attempting removal leaving ~30 cm of retained microcatheter extending from the occipital artery into the common carotid.A solitaire stentriever was used off label to capture the fractured microcatheter and then a larger caliber microcatheter was railroaded over it.Retrieval of the fractured microcatheter by the stentriever was then facilitated by counter traction on the onyx cast using the larger microcatheter.Postembolization cerebral angiogram demonstrated no complications.The patient awoke neurologically intact and had an uneventful postoperative course.
